Electricity Generation Using Small Wind Turbines for Home
The key feature of a small wind energy system is the wind turbine. The turbine uses the energy of motion (kinetic energy) from the wind to turn a shaft, thus making mechanical energy.
The ideal wind speed range for home wind turbines typically falls between 12 to 25 mph (5 to 11 m/s). Within this range, turbines can operate efficiently without the risk of shutting down due to excessive speed or failing to generate enough power.

Most residential turbines range from 1 to 100 kW. Height requirements – Wind speed increases with height. A turbine needs to be mounted high enough to access stronger winds, usually on a tower 20-140 ft (6-43 m) tall. Sound considerations – While modern turbines are quieter, all will produce some sound.
3. What Wind Speed Is Considered “Good” for Wind Energy? The U.S. Department of Energy considers average wind speeds of 10 to 12 mph (4.5 to 5.5 m/s) at hub height to be the minimum for cost-effective small wind turbine installation.
